Fresh from his mammoth debut World Triathlon Championship Series win in Karlovy Vary, Germany's latest triathlon talent Henry Graf joins Doug Gray and Tommy Zaferes for a full run-down of the latest and greatest Battle of Bohemia!

📈 Being nearly two metres tall in an era of smaller, faster triathletes

🍿 Winning your debut the same day as Ironman short-distancers light up Nice – shouts to Casper Stornes, Gustav Iden, Kristian Blummenfelt and friend Jonas Schomburg

💪 Taylor Spivey’s mega bike effort to catch onto Maya Kingma’s mega bike effort

🐠 Oliver Conway’s impressive debut with 4th place new talent coming off the GB production line

💥 Beth Potter back on top of the podium and Jeanne Lehair bouncing back from bashing the barrier

🦿 Hitting the KV roads hard with breakaway boys Tjebbe Kaindl and Mark Devay

✍️ Hayden Wilde’s pre-race car incident, Swim behaviour penalties, John Reed clocking the rapid runs, prospects for a Series podium and his chances of taking Csongor Lehmann’s crown in Tiszy
